#60c10d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#60c10d is composed of 37.6% red, 75.7%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.3%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 92.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 40.4%. #60c10d color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ff1a with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#60c10d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050901 is the darkest color, while #fafef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#60c10d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676a64 is the less saturated color, while #5fc905 is the most saturated one.
